Home again

Finally started for home from GA on Sat via I75, I81, I88. Did two overnights on the way. One at Fort Chiswell RV park and one at Cracker Barrel. All contact was via Internet or phone.
Plaid it safe. Stocked up with food and fresh water and the only travel contact was with a diesel pump twice and had gloves on for that.
Some states are using the decrease in traffic to do road repairs and that is good because our Interstates need a lot of work. I did observe that the worst roads were in the states that have the highest fuel tax. Hit no work zones in those states.
Now we're suppose to be isolated for 14 days, but the golf clubs are a collin'

Just wondering how other snowbirds are doing.
